## Authentication

The hermetic migration for the Lintbarrow build means no ambient credentials. The sandbox strips environment variables, so the fetch step must be given an explicit token for the internal artifact cache (Cratewell). Old netrc-based auth no longer works. Rotate keys per release branch; never reuse the trunk key. Add the key to your local overrides file before running the migration script. The current Cratewell key is as follows.

API key for fahip-kahip: zpat23_XiJGUHz5xfaAtaIqUkus0rh

Ticket: Slim the Pondrel worker image. The current image ships build toolchains and docs that inflate pulls to 1.4 GB, slowing cold starts on the Ferncrest cluster. Switch to a distroless base, strip debug symbols, and move test fixtures out of the runtime layer. Target is under 400 MB. A candidate image passed smoke tests; the build token is below.

pipeline stamp: htk31_f769b577b3028a4e9958e5bb8d1259a

Subject: On-call heads-up — Orchardly catalog cache. Welcome aboard. The main gotcha: catalog price updates invalidate by SKU, but bundle pages cache composite keys, so a stale bundle can outlive its parts. If support reports wrong bundle prices, purge the composite namespace first. We'll cover this at the weekly sync; the invalidation playbook is on this internal page.

wiki page, yagef-tawif: https://sentry.lumicdata.local/view/merge_requests/pipeline/merge_requests/e08f7f35c80b5755

# Marketing Budget Cut — Managers Only

Heads up, team: the Q3 marketing budget for the Lumabrand campaign is being trimmed by roughly 20%. Paid placements in the Osterfield region take the biggest hit; events are mostly safe. Please brief your leads quietly before the all-hands. The reasoning behind the cut is summarised in the confidential note below.

board note of bawep-tajef: Queniusek Systems plans to raise the Quenvan list price by 53.1 percent in March. The pricing group signed off on a budget of $176.4 million for Project Drueth. The renewal with Casionix Partners closes at $142.5 million a year, 8.3 percent below the last contract. Project Fraax slips by six weeks because of the tooling delay.